Boris Johnson says easing of restrictions will be welcome relief for businesses that have been closed

People should enjoy new freedoms but remain wary of the risks, Boris Johnson has said, as beer gardens, alfresco restaurants, shops and salons prepared to reopen across England on Monday for the first time in almost four months.

The prime minister hailed the reopening – a major and “irreversible” step in the roadmap of easing restrictions – as “a chance to get back to doing some of the things we love and have missed”.
